About the Role

We are seeking an experienced Industrial Strategy Director to join our team at Schneider Electric Norge AS. As a key member of our Global Supply Chain organization, you will play a critical role in driving our industrial strategy and ensuring the successful execution of our projects.

Key Responsibilities
  • Industrial Strategy:
    • Develop and implement a comprehensive industrial strategy for our North America operations, aligned with our global business objectives.
    • Drive the preparation of Long-Term Industrial Plans (LTIP) at the plant level, providing strategic inputs and project management expertise.
    • Consolidate LTIPs for the entire cluster, ensuring alignment with global industrial strategy and local considerations to drive optimization, efficiency, and customer proximity.
    • Serve as the single point of contact for launching new initiatives or projects within the cluster.
  • Rebalancing:
    • Periodically review finished products being imported in North America for sale and identify opportunities to manufacture those products locally.
    • Review parts being imported by plants in North America and explore opportunities to localize those parts in Mexico or North America.
    • Formalize rebalancing projects based on these inputs, GSC-T strategy, and drive them to successful execution.
    • Ensure rebalancing numbers reported by each plant and cluster are 100% aligned with GSC-T industrial database reporting.
  • Project Management:
    • Lead the execution of transfer, rebalancing, QVE, and main industrial projects for the cluster, ensuring efficient execution within quality, lead time, and cost constraints.
    • Secure the right resources for projects through plant and function teams, resolving priority conflicts when necessary to ensure timely project delivery.
    • Maintain strong links with GSC-T, BU Industrialization, BU Quality, Plant GMs, and other stakeholders to ensure high collaboration among teams.
    • Assemble strong and motivated project teams focused on delivering high-quality results.
    • Identify talents and mentor/coach for talent development.
    • Drive a culture of high performance, speed, transparency, and trust.
  • Resource Management:
    • Monitor resource needs and availability to manage project prioritization.
    • Anticipate future needs and make resources available accordingly.
    • Ensure necessary training is provided to resources according to project needs.
Requirements
  • Undergraduate or Graduate Degree in Engineering or Supply Chain.
  • Minimum 15 years of experience in a Supply Chain environment of a Multinational corporation.
  • Deep understanding of manufacturing and project management.
  • Clear understanding of SE Industrial policies and practices.
  • Strong experience in Supply Chain management of technical commodities.
  • Experience in driving strong and successful execution of projects.
  • Comfortable with functional reporting (dotted/dual line) as well as hierarchical mode (direct/solid line) in large matrix organizations.
